SETPOINT PROGRAMMING
From the weight display, press to access the setpoint setting.
: to enter a menu/confirm the data entry.
: to modify the displayed figure or menu item.
: to select a new figure or modify the displayed menu item.
: to cancel and return to the previous menu.
- (from 0 to max full scale; default: 0): Setpoint; relay switching occurs when the weight
exceed the value set in this parameter. The type of switching is settable (see section OUTPUTS
AND INPUTS CONFIGURATION).
- (from 0 to max full scale; default: 0): Hysteresis, value to be subtracted from the setpoint
to obtain contact switching for decreasing weight. For example with a setpoint at 100 and
hysteresis at 10, the switching occurs at 90 for decreasing weight.
These values are set to zero if the calibration is changed significantly (see sections
THEORETICAL CALIBRATION and REAL CALIBRATION (WITH SAMPLE WEIGHTS)).
